Charles Dickens' novels famously portrayed the life of the working classes during the Industrial Revolution. His works, such as Oliver Twist (1838) and A Tale of Two Cities (1859), depicted the struggles and challenges faced by the lower and middle classes in Victorian England, shedding light on the social issues of the time.
